15 lines
597 B
Docker
15 lines
597 B
Docker
FROM php:8.4-apache
|
|
|
|
RUN apt-get -y update && \
|
|
apt-get -y upgrade && \
|
|
apt-get -y install libicu-dev libgd-dev libonig-dev unzip libpq-dev libzip-dev libxml2-dev libldb-dev libldap2-dev libmemcached-dev
|
|
|
|
RUN docker-php-ext-install gd intl mbstring mysqli pdo pdo_pgsql pdo_mysql zip bcmath soap ldap
|
|
RUN pecl install msgpack igbinary redis
|
|
RUN docker-php-ext-enable msgpack igbinary redis
|
|
RUN pecl install memcached pcov
|
|
RUN docker-php-ext-enable memcached pcov
|
|
|
|
RUN apt-get -y purge --auto-remove && apt-get clean && \
|
|
rm -rf /var/lib/apt/lists/* /tmp/* /var/tmp/* /usr/share/doc/*
|